The European Congenital Cytomegalovirus Initiative (ECCI) 2020 was held online from November 13-14, 2020. This congress focused on congenital cytomegalovirus (CMV) infection, the most common congenital viral infection worldwide, and aimed to address research gaps and promote public awareness
Main Topics
The congress covered a variety of important topics, including:
- Prevention and treatment of primary infection during pregnancy
- Diagnosis of fetal disease during pregnancy
- Treatment of children with congenital CMV
- Hearing loss in congenital CMV
- Prognostic evaluation of fetal infection
- Immunology and vaccine development
This congress provided a platform for experts to share the latest research, clinical practices, and innovations in the field of congenital CMV, fostering collaboration and knowledge exchange
